6 Star 1 Fork 1

苏苏苏大强 / vue3-base-h5

加入 Gitee
与超过 1200万 开发者一起发现、参与优秀开源项目,私有仓库也完全免费 :)
免费加入
该仓库未声明开源许可证文件(LICENSE),使用请关注具体项目描述及其代码上游依赖。
克隆/下载
贡献代码
同步代码
取消
提示: 由于 Git 不支持空文件夾,创建文件夹后会生成空的 .keep 文件
Loading...
README

基于vue3 + vite + vant 开箱即用框架(移动端)

1. 待办

  • 集成echarts
  • 集成高德地图
  • eslint+prettier 代码校验和格式化
  • ...

2.项目文件说明

  • .env.development(参数VITE_APP_PROXY_UR 根据项目需要填写对应的代理域名)
  • src
    • api
      • module (存放对应模块的api接口请求)
      • comm(存放公共的api接口请求)
    • assets(存放图片文件)
    • component(存放公共组件)
    • hooks
      • module (存放功能模块)
    • lib
      • amap(封装的高德地图组件)
      • echarts(封装的echarts组件)
    • router
      • module(存放模块文件)
      • index(路由入口)
    • store
      • module(存放模块文件)
      • index(状态管理入口)
    • style
      • comm**(公共模块)
      • index(样式入口)
    • utils
      • auth(仅token本地存储相关操作)
      • common(公共工具)
      • request*(axios请求)
      • sha1(接口登陆密码加密文件)
    • view
      • demo (示例文件,可删除)
      • error-page (用于404页面跳转)
      • login (用于本地登陆获取token调试使用)

注:其他文件根据自己需要做删减

3.接口调试说明

不推荐:mock.js

推荐使用ApiFox软件作为mock的替代,只需要将接口文档导入再开启远程mock开关,即可自动按照接口定义的规则生成数据源,方便调试使用 ####APIFox使用方法点击这里

4.注意事项

  • 1.除了demo文件可以删除其他资源可以保留,如有需要可自行根据业务情况进行删改
  • 2.vite.config.js文件里的'/api'代理的是APIFOX的在线mock地址,仅用于本地调试使用
  • 3.setting.js文件中的AMAP_KEY仅用于调试使用,上线请替换使用自己申请的key及index.html页面的securityJsCode值
  • 4.login文件不建议删除,方便本地获取token调试使用,接口为真实接口返回的token,只有在开发环境才会出现此页面,构建后的线上出现401等未授权情况将不会跳转到此页面,可放心使用

空文件

简介

基于vue3+vite+vant,集成echarts,高德地图h5基础框架 展开 收起
JavaScript 等 4 种语言
取消

发行版

暂无发行版

贡献者

全部

近期动态

加载更多
不能加载更多了
JavaScript
1
https://gitee.com/joke.com/vue3-base-h5.git
git@gitee.com:joke.com/vue3-base-h5.git
joke.com
vue3-base-h5
vue3-base-h5
master

搜索帮助